When did Augustin de Iturbide declare independence?
zimovet [89]

Agustín de Iturbide was born on September 27, 1783 in Valladolid, Mexico. When the Revolution first began, he started as an officer and then became the commander of the Northern Mexican army. Wanting to find a way to peacefully gain independence from Spain, Iturbide helped create the Plan of Iguala,<u> issued in 1821.</u>
